Mitsubishi Triton

The Mitsibishi Triton was officially launched today. It replaces the L200 Storm which was lead the way being the first 4×4 truck to have an automatic transmission then. The Triton also breaks new ground. No longer is it squarish like most 4×4 trucks you see on the roads in here. It’s rather futuristic especially when view from the side.

Triton Front

It has a curvy rear box and look part of the cab rather than a box that is stuck to the rear like in the current twin cab truck. The Triton look attractive and comes with a newly developed 2.5-litre turbodiesel intercooled engine with 135bhp at 3,500rpm and torque of 314Nm at 2,000rpm. It’s four-wheel drive system has a high-low transfer ratio and a hybrid limited slip differential to reduce wheel slip under extreme conditions.

Triton Rear

With the power rating, it will overtake Nissan’s Frontier as the most powerful 4×4 truck on our shores.
